Overview
Enterprise Products Operating LLC - Fordyce Pump Station is a distribution pump station in Fordyce, Arkansas, United States. It supports critical fluid transport infrastructure in the region.
Enterprise Products Operating LLC - Fordyce Pump Station is a distribution pump station located at 4560 Hwy 189 N in Fordyce, Cleveland County, Arkansas, United States. The facility is operational and plays a key role in the regional distribution network for fluids, likely related to natural gas liquids or refined products given the operator's industry focus. The station operates under U.S. federal and state regulations, including pipeline safety standards from the Pipeline and Hazardous Materials Safety Administration (PHMSA) and Arkansas state codes. As a distribution pump station, it is designed to maintain pressure and flow within the pipeline system, ensuring reliable transport to downstream customers. This facility contributes to the energy supply chain in the region, supporting industrial and commercial activities in Arkansas. Its location along Highway 189 N provides strategic access to major transport routes, enhancing operational efficiency and redundancy for the broader pipeline network.
